Question About Olympus P-440 Dye Sub Printer
Does anyone here have experience with this printer? I've used the Canon dye sub for small prints and found it produced excellent results. The idea of similar results in an 8X10 print is tempting. -- Remove NOSPAM to reply |

-- Remove NOSPAM to reply "Larry" wrote in message ews.com... In article , says... Does anyone here have experience with this printer? I've used the Canon dye sub for small prints and found it produced excellent results. The idea of similar results in an 8X10 print is tempting. Its a good printer, but it has some limitations. As it comes out of the box it can only print full page or 2 4x6 on a page. Firmware update for 2-up 5x7 is $99 (US). If used with Qimage or Photoshop you can get good results, but DONT use the printer driver to resize the print as it doesn't use the best algorythms and if the driver re-sizes the picture it could be somewhat jaggie. The consumables are expensive $29.99 for a 25 pack of paper $49.99 for ribbon for 50 prints. These are retail US prices. -- Larry Lynch Mystic, Ct. Thanks for the reply.
